From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) (web1913)
Briny \Brin"y\, a. [From {Brine}.]
Of or pertaining to brine, or to the sea; partaking of the
nature of brine; salt; as, a briny taste; the briny flood.
From WordNet (r) 1.7 (wn)
briny
adj : slightly salty; "a brackish lagoon"; "the briny deep" [syn:
{brackish}]
n : any very large body of (salt) water [syn: {main}]
